in_array()函數用于在數組中搜索指定的值。它的調用方式如下:
in_array(要搜索的值, 數組, 是否進行嚴格比較);
其中,要搜索的值是要在數組中查找的值,數組是要搜索的數組,是否進行嚴格比較是一個可選參數,默認值為false,表示不進行嚴格比較。
以下是一些示例:
$fruits = array("apple", "banana", "orange");
// 在數組中搜索值 "banana",不進行嚴格比較
if (in_array("banana", $fruits)) {
echo "找到了";
} else {
echo "沒有找到";
}
// 在數組中搜索值 "grape",進行嚴格比較
if (in_array("grape", $fruits, true)) {
echo "找到了";
} else {
echo "沒有找到";
}
輸出結果為:
找到了
沒有找到